Roboguard Wireless Dual-PIR Sensor
This is a wire-free battery-operated dual-PIR sensor, designed to detect human movement and wirelessly
transmit the information to a Roboguard base station. This Dual-PIR sensor technology can detect movement up to 20 metres away, or
using a simple switch can shorten the detection range to either 10 m or 15 m depending on the dimensions of your property.
The Roboguard Dual-PIR Sensor is specifically designed as an early warning device and therefore is particularly suitable for zone
2 (driveway) and zone 4 (remote) locations due to low battery power consumption and the fact that it is a complete wire-
free sensor. The Roboguard Dual-PIR Sensor can also be used in zone 3 (curtilage) locations, but are not as feature rich as the
Maximum Outdoor security products, which offer additional active infrared and microwave technology security features.
These sensors have a 30 microamp (30µA) current consumption. Batteries typically last up to 3 years, if properly
maintained. The sensor will send a signal to the remote handheld decoder panel if low battery
power is detected and has a tamper alarm which triggers when the cover is removed.

Maximum Security (1984) wall "Guard"
Outdoor Motion Detector
This is a combined Double PIR sensor with Microwave technology. The wall "GUARD" has two synchronized PIR
sensors that produce a 3D thermal image of the protected area, which it combines with microwave scanning technology to provide
enhanced detection capability with increased reliability and immunity to false alarms. Using this technique allows high
sensitivity level adjustment in both detection technologies without the need for a pulse count.
The Guard Sensor is ideal for zone 3 (curtilage) locations. This sensor includes active infrared and microwave technology making
it one of the most advanced sensors on the market. The sensor has a range of sophisticated tamper protection features, such as
vibration detection (to detect if the sensor is being moved) and anti-masking detection (to detect if the sensor lens is being
covered or spray-painted).
These sensors have a current draw of 24mA @ 12V and requires its own 12V DC power source. The sensor can be connected to a range
of alarm systems, including the Roboguard system when connected to a wireless transmitter. An optional multi-directional wall
mounted bracket is also available.

Maximum Security (1984) "Out-Smart"
Outdoor Motion Detector
This is a combined Double PIR sensor with Microwave technology. This is the latest sensor from Maximum Security
and is similar in design to the wall "Guard". However this sensor is more flexible with bracket-free mounting. There is an
internal multi-directional adjustment system that allows the internal sensor unit to rotate horizontally 180 degrees. This ensure
that you can aim the sensor detection area in the area you want and adjust it later for further optimisation with having to remove
the sensor off the wall. The "Out-Smart" sensor can also be controlled by its own remote control (optional).
The Out-Smart Sensor is ideal for zone 3 (curtilage) locations, but can also be used in more remote locations (with access
to a power source) as the sensor can be installed 1 to 2 meters
high. Similar to the wall Guard, this
sensor includes active infrared and microwave technology making it one of the most advanced sensors on the market. The sensor has
a similar range of sophisticated tamper protection features.
These sensors have a current draw of 35mA @ 12V and requires its own 12V DC power source. The sensor can be connected to a range
of alarm systems, including the Roboguard system when connected to a wireless transmitter. There is also a specific DVR/Camera
Trigger which activates and latches a relay output for 10 seconds allowing for automatic recording of images.

Maximum Security (1984) "Active 50 / 100"
Perimeter Beams
ACTIVE is a dual-beam outdoor / indoor active infrared detection system. ACTIVE consists of two parts, an
infrared transmitter and its receiver. An alarm is activated when someone crosses the pair of active infrared beams. This
activates the changeover relay on the receiver part and lights the (switchable) red LED. The ACTIVE detection system is waterproof
and all-weather resistant, with excellent lightening protection and sensitivity adjustments for all conditions. In order to
eliminate any attempt of neutralize the receiver part by means of a foreign IR transmitter, constant synchronization exists
between the infrared transmitter and its receiver. This also ensures excellent immunity from false alarms. The ACTIVE beams can
also send "trouble" alerts if the detection of rain, snow, fog, heavy dust, etc. results in a reduction in quality of electronic
eye contact between the two parts of the system. The beams have a straightforward on-board alignment meter that ensure that both
transmitter and receiver are correctly positioned.
The ACTIVE Beam sensor is ideal for zone 1 (perimeter) and zone 2 (driveway) locations, but can also be used in more remote
locations (with access to a power source). The sensor can be installed at any height but it is generally recommended that they are
installed somewhere between 0.5 to 2 meters high. The area between the transmitter and the receiver must have a clear line of
sight to avoid false triggers.
The transmitter has a current draw of 57mA and receiver 30mA. They require their own 12V DC power source. The sensor can be
connected to a range of alarm systems, including the Roboguard system when connected to a wireless transmitter.
